Effect of tribulus terrestris on serum luteinizing hormone in Sprague Dawley rats

ABSTRACT
Background:
Tribulus terrestris is a creeping herb that has been used in the past for treating impotence. The extract obtained from Tribulus mainly contains the active component protodioscin. Administration of the extract improves libido and spermatogenesis. Protodioscin increases the levels of luteinizing hormone [LH], testosterone, dehydroepiandrosterone [DHEA] and dihydrotestosterone [DHT]. The objective of present study was to determine the effect of Tribulus terrestris on serum luteinizing hormone in male Sprague Dawley rats
